I think Butler is the MVP. if he doesn't tackle the Seattle receiver at the six yard line, Seattle strolls in for the TD. Only Butler runs over to tackle him, everyone else thought the play was dead. And if Butler doesn't intercept at the 1, all the Seattle receiver has to do is fall over and he's in the end zone.

Wilson's passes were amazing, so crisp, right on target. And the play using Lynch as a WR really caught the Pats napping.

No doubt, Seattle remains a force.

Yeah Paul, I'm still baffled by that play call. Walter Jr. is a mess over it! I still can't believe they thought throwing the ball into the middle of the field would be a smart move, especially with Carroll saying they needed to stop the clock since they only had 1 timeout left. Throwing to the middle isn't stopping anything and it's not like he was in the end zone anyway. Run Lynch on 2nd down and then call timeout, if he doesn't make it then call timeout with two plays still to go and plenty of time to throw one to the end zone. There will be internal problems over this with Seattle's team.
